5-10-2015 Ethical Matters for God’s People in His Universe
Series: Worldviews
Cosmology – We are God’s special creation and therefore have best reasons to treasure and protect our world as fellow worshippers with Creation, as those tasked to care-take this broken Garden, joining Christ in his restoration and looking forward to its complete redemption. Human Nature – Christians have the strongest argument for human dignity, the most realistic explanations of the human condition and the best hope for human fulfillment Ethics & Morality – The most reasonable source of ethical behavior would reasonably spring from a perfect, just, all-knowing and merciful personality who, as an added bonus and our only real hope, has walked in our shoes.

  • Feb 22, 20152-22-2015 Does Your Worldview Pass the Test?
    Feb 22, 2015
    2-22-2015 Does Your Worldview Pass the Test?
    Series: Worldviews
    Key verse: Acts 17:18b-20 - Some of them asked, “What is this babbler trying to say?” Others remarked, “He seems to be advocating foreign gods.” They said this because Paul was preaching the good news about Jesus and the resurrection. 19 Then they took him and brought him to a meeting of the Areopagus, where they said to him, “May we know what this new teaching is that you are presenting? 20 You are bringing some strange ideas to our ears, and we would like to know what they mean.”
     
    In his usual “day job” Russ teaches the Worldviews classes for graduating Seniors at Black Forest Academy (BFA).  BFA is a school primarily for “Missionary Kids” whose families work in Europe, Africa and Asia.  His Worldview sermon series will attempt to present an overview of worldviews thinking for Christian believers as they live in an increasingly diverse and global context.
